About South Plympton 5038

The size of South Plympton is approximately 1.6 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 4.4% of total area. The population of South Plympton in 2016 was 4174 people. By 2021 the population was 4721 showing a population growth of 13.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in South Plympton is 30-39 years. Households in South Plympton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in South Plympton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.00% of the homes in South Plympton were owner-occupied compared with 65.30% in 2016.

South Plympton has 2,382 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in South Plympton have seen a 96.14%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 82.90%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in South Plympton is $1,087,824 while the median value for Units is $595,925.
  • Houses have a median rent of $650 while Units have a median rent of $510.
